Studies reveal that the mix of these treatments is more reliable than either of them alone. Depression (major depressive problem) prevails. It impacts 5% to 17% of individuals at some time in their lives. Depression (major depressive disorder) creates a persistently reduced or clinically depressed mood and a loss of rate of interest in activities that you utilized to take pleasure in. The symptoms must last for at the very least two weeks to receive a diagnosis. The problem is treatable, generally with medication and psychotherapy. Clinical depression varies from one person to another, yet there are some typical signs and symptoms. It is necessary to keep in mind that these signs can be part of life's regular lows. But the more symptoms you have, the more powerful they are, and the longer they've lasted-- the more probable it is that you're handling clinical depression. Some people may really feel generally miserable or miserable without actually knowing why.
